Struct gtk4_sys::GtkAccessibleInterface
source · #[repr(C)]pub struct GtkAccessibleInterface {
pub g_iface: GTypeInterface,
pub get_at_context: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kATContext>,
pub get_platform_state: Option<unsafe extern "C" fn(_: *mut GtkAccessible, _: GtkAccessiblePlatformState) -> gboolean>,
pub get_accessible_parent: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>,
pub get_first_accessible_child: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>,
pub get_next_accessible_sibling: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>,
pub get_bounds: Option<unsafe extern "C" fn(_: *mut GtkAccessible, _: *mut c_int, _: *mut c_int, _: *mut c_int, _: *mut c_int) -> gboolean>,
}
Fields§
§g_iface: GTypeInterface
§get_at_context: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kATContext>
§get_platform_state: Option<unsafe extern "C" fn(_: *mut GtkAccessible, _: GtkAccessiblePlatformState) -> gboolean>
§get_accessible_parent: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>
§get_first_accessible_child: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>
§get_next_accessible_sibling: Option<unsafe extern "C" fn(_: *mut GtkAccessible) -> *mut GtkAccessible>
§get_bounds: Option<unsafe extern "C" fn(_: *mut GtkAccessible, _: *mut c_int, _: *mut c_int, _: *mut c_int, _: *mut c_int) -> gboolean>
Trait Implementations§
source§impl Clone for GtkAccessibleInterface
impl Clone for GtkAccessibleInterface
source§fn clone(&self) -> GtkAccessibleInterface
fn clone(&self) -> GtkAccessibleInterface
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read more